pub struct Icmp { /* fields omitted */ }
The Internet Control Message Protocol (v6).
Methods
impl Icmp
[src]
fn v4() -> Icmp
Represents a ICMP.
Examples
use asyncio::Endpoint; use asyncio::ip::{Icmp, IcmpEndpoint, IpAddrV4}; let ep = IcmpEndpoint::new(IpAddrV4::any(), 0); assert_eq!(Icmp::v4(), ep.protocol());
fn v6() -> Icmp
Represents a ICMPv6.
Examples
use asyncio::Endpoint; use asyncio::ip::{Icmp, IcmpEndpoint, IpAddrV6}; let ep = IcmpEndpoint::new(IpAddrV6::any(), 0); assert_eq!(Icmp::v6(), ep.protocol());
